Editorial Reviews:

Product Description
A connoisseur's compendium of Freudian slips,spoonerisms, double-talk, and utter bosh from famousand infamous figures past and present -- acomplete course in anti-eloquence by the foot-in-mouthchampions of all time.

3 out of 5 stars Fun, but not all it's cracked up to be   May 24, 2001
  14 out of 21 found this review helpful

The book's promo implies that it is a collection of blunders by famous people. This is partly true. There are some interesting malapropisms and other goofs from famed people, but there are also a lot of obscure, random entries from nameless or otherwise unknown people. For example, some quotes are credited to, "An Irish Politician" or other nameless people.

In summary, some aspects are entertaining and the book is unique. For quote fanatics, it is worthwhile addition to your collection if you have the money to spare.
